No turn signals / hazard flasher and some curious dashboard ligh Reply #4 – February 01, 2015, 07:50:27 am Yahoo Message Number: 150708On my '08. the hazard flashers and turn signals operate off a single flasher. Mine was a pale blue color, located near the left wall and fairly low under the dash, where the side wall meets the firewall. It was about a 1" cube in size and was floating free, not anchored to the wall. If you have a bad flasher, that might account for both being out.Ken F in NM
